边界条件
FLUENT不收敛的解决方法
FLUENT不收敛的解决方法解决FLUENT不收敛的问题是一个复杂的过程,因为它涉及到多个因素的相互影响。下面是一些解决FLUENT不收敛问题的常用方法:1.初始条件的选择:在开始数值求解之前,需要确定一个合适的初始条件。初始条件对于解的收敛性至关重要。初始条件应该尽可能接近真实的解,以便尽快地达到收敛状态。正则化收敛速率2.网格的质量:网格的质量对于解的收敛性有重要影响。不合适的网格质量可能导致...
Abaqus选项内容讲解
总规则1、关键字必须以*号开头,且关键字前无空格2、**为注释行,它可以出现在文件中的任何地方3、当关键字后带有参数时,关键词后必须采用逗号隔开4、参数间都采用逗号隔开5、关键词可以采用简写的方式,只要程序能识别就可以了6、不需使用隔行符,如果参数比较多,一行放不下,可以另起一行,只要在上一行的末尾加逗号便可以*AMPLITUDE:定义幅值曲线 amplitude这个选项允许任意的载荷、位移和其它...
鲁棒robustness 测试原则
正则化项鲁棒性鲁棒 robustness 测试原则鲁棒性测试是一种评估系统在异常情况下的性能和稳定性的软件测试方法。其原则主要包括以下几点:异常输入:鲁棒测试特别关注提供无效、不完整或非预期的输入数据,以模拟异常情况。这些输入可能包括错误的格式、超出范围的值、缺失的数据等。通过测试系统对这些异常输入的反应,可以评估其处理错误的能力。错误处理:鲁棒测试强调系统在面对错误时的处理机制。系统应能正确地检...
微分方程中的边值问题与特解求解技巧
微分方程中的边值问题与特解求解技巧微分方程是描述自然现象和数学模型中常见的数学工具,它涉及到函数与其导数之间的关系。在微分方程的研究过程中,边值问题和特解的求解是非常重要的。本文将介绍微分方程中的边值问题以及一些常用的特解求解技巧。侧边值问题一定要用正则化吗一、边值问题边值问题是指在微分方程中给定一些边界条件,要求求解满足这些条件的特解。常见的边值问题有两类:两点边值问题和混合边值问题。1. 两点...
常微分方程的边值问题
常微分方程的边值问题常微分方程的边值问题(也称为常微分方程的定边值问题)是求解一个微分方程在一个给定的时间段上的特定解的问题,其中方程的解需要满足一些给定的边界条件。这些边界条件通常指定了方程在时间间隔的起点和终点处的值,或者其他一些特定的时刻或位置上的值。例如,一个常见的常微分方程的边值问题是求解一个二阶常微分方程:y''(t) = f(t, y(t))其中,y(t) 是未知函数,f(t, y)...
电磁场的边值条件公式
电磁场的边值条件公式主要分为三类:第一类边界条件、第二类边界条件和第三类边界条件。这些条件在解决电磁场问题时是非常重要的,它们描述了电磁场在不同区域或边界上的行为。侧边值问题一定要用正则化吗1.第一类边界条件:U_s=f(r_s,t)。简单理解就是给个值,这个值可以随时间变化。2.第二类边界条件:frac{ \partial U}{ \partial n} |_s = f(n,t)。简单理解就是给...
基于正则化方法的阶梯边界条件反问题研究
基于正则化方法的阶梯边界条件反问题研究阶梯边界条件反问题是一类重要的反问题,其在实际应用中具有广泛的应用价值。为了解决这类问题,研究者们提出了许多方法,其中正则化方法是一种常用的方法。正则化方法是一种通过引入某种先验信息来约束反问题解的方法。在阶梯边界条件反问题中,正则化方法可以通过引入边界条件的平滑性来约束反问题解。具体来说,可以通过引入二阶导数的平方作为正则化项,来约束反问题解的平滑性。这样做...
字符串常见题目
字符串常见题⽬☆1.模拟⼀个trim()⽅法,去除字符串两端的空格。public String myTrim(String str){int start = 0;int end = str.length() - 1;while(start < end && str.charAt(start) == ' '){start++;}while(start < end &...
字符串修改编程题
字符串修改编程题 字符串修改编程题是一道常见的编程题目,要求对给定的字符串进行修改。修改的方式可以有多种,如替换、删除、添加等。一般来说,字符串修改编程题需要考虑以下几个方面: 1. 字符串的基本操作:字符串是由一组字符组成的,所以要对字符串进行修改,首先要了解字符串的基本操作,如截取、拼接、比较等。字符串函数gets怎么重新定义 &...
有限元算例二维传热c++程序源代码5
{ ai=pE[i*2+j*ny*2].a[idx]; bi=pE[i*2+j*ny*2].b[idx]; &n...
fluent典型问题
1 对于刚接触到FLUENT新手来说,面对铺天盖地的学习资料和令人难读的FLUENT help,如何学习才能在最短的时间内入门并掌握基本学习方法呢?2 CFD计算中涉及到的流体及流动的基本概念和术语:理想流体和粘性流体;牛顿流体和非牛顿流体;可压缩流体和不可压缩流体;层流和湍流;定常流动和非定常流动;亚音速与超音速流动;热传导和扩散等。3 在数值模拟过程中,如何对控制方程进行离散?如何对计算区域进...
Fluent经典问题及答疑2
Fluent经典问题及答疑251 对于出口有回流的问题,在出口应该选用什么样的边界条件(压力出口边界条件、质量出口边界条件等)计算效果会更好?(#42) 52 对于不同求解器,离散格式的选择应注意哪些细节?实际计算中一阶迎风差分与二阶迎风差分有什么异同? (#69)53 对于FLUENT的耦合解算器,对时间步进格式的主要控制是Courant数(CF...
boundary conditions 造句
boundary conditions 造句values什么意思boundary conditions 造句如下:1、It has k2 as the boundary conditions.它有k 2作为限制条件。2、Testing boundary conditions forces you to question your assumptions.测试...
hydrus说明书部分中文版
This tutorial considers water flow and solute transport in a simple three-dimensional transport domain. The transport domain is a relatively simple hexahedral domain with a slope in the X-direction. D...
COMSOL使用中产生问题及解决办法
MEMS 交流网 seCOMSOL Multiphysics 问题集合——搜集自中方科技网站 wwwtech汇总:【PDE/ODE 等方程】 COMSOL Multiphysics 阶跃平滑过渡【PDE/ODE 等方程】 COMSOL Multiphysics 能计算磁力吗?【PDE/ODE 等方程】 COMSOL Multiphysics...
matlab解谱方法,Matlab微分方程高效解法:谱方法原理与实现
matlab解谱⽅法,Matlab微分⽅程⾼效解法:谱⽅法原理与实现出版说明序前⾔提⽰上篇 前置知识第1章 初值问题和边值问题1.1 初值问题1.1.1 欧拉法1.1.2 局部截断误差1.1.3 改进的欧拉法1.1.4 龙格-库塔法1.1.5 ode系列函数的⽤法1.1.6 ⾼阶微分⽅程的降阶1.2 边值问题1.2.1 打靶法1.2.2 bvp系列函数的⽤法第2章 有限差分法和有限元法2.1 有限...
过约束ErrNodeBCInactiveDof
1 nodes have inactive dof on which boundary conditions are specified. The nodes have been identified in node set ErrNodeBCInactiveDof.2 1 nodes have inactive dof on which boundary conditions are speci...
运行python命令_sfepy:python有限元分析模块介绍-【2】从命令行运行命令...
运⾏python命令_sfepy:python有限元分析模块介绍-【2】从命令⾏运⾏命令进。。。下⾯简单介绍⼀下,采⽤sfepy进⾏有限元分析的⽅法,这⾥注意⼏点:1、sfepy只是进⾏有限元分析计算,前道⼯序,⼏何建模是⽤其他⼯具完成,建议⽤gmesh,后⾯会撰⽂介绍,sfepy可以设置材料参数、边界条件等;2、后道处理是调⽤mayavi来进⾏显⽰,这⼀块兼容性问题很⼤,如果不需要,可以不⽤安装...
编程实现斐波那契数列(递归)
编程实现斐波那契数列(递归)斐波那契数列是一个非常著名的数列,它以数列中每个元素都是前两个元素之和来定义,即F(n) = F(n-1) + F(n-2)。这个数列的前几项为0、1、1、2、3、5、8、13……用递归的方法实现斐波那契数列的代码如下:```编程递归函数def fibonacci(n): if n <= 0: &n...
C语言.switch选择条件语句的范围判断表达方法
C语⾔.switch选择条件语句的范围判断表达⽅法 switch语句可以⽤…来判断范围,要注意其边界条件(且为包含),其表达⽅式如下switch(x){99: //等价于 0<=x &&am...
三次样条插值python代码
三次样条插值python代码三次样条插值Python代码介绍三次样条插值是一种常用的数值分析方法,可以用于数据的平滑处理和函数的近似拟合。在Python中,可以使用SciPy库中的interpolate模块实现三次样条插值。原理三次样条插值是将给定的数据点拟合成一组连续的三次函数,使得函数在每个数据点处具有一阶和二阶连续性。这些函数被称为样条函数,它们是由一系列二次和三次多项式组成的。代码实现下面...
leetcode高频100题python
leetcode高频100题python以下是leetcode高频100题的Python解答:1. 两数之和```pythondef twoSum(nums, target): num_dict = {} for i, num in enumerate(nums): complement =...
数学建模MATLAB学习插值一维插值函数、三次样条插值
数学建模MATLAB学习插值⼀维插值函数、三次样条插值1.⼀维插值函数Matlab中有现成的⼀维插值函数interp1,语法为y=interp1(x0,y0,x,'method')x0,y0是已知的数据向量,其中x应以升序或者降序排列(所有的插值⽅法要求x0是单调的),x1是插值点的⾃变量坐标向量;其中method指定插值的⽅法,默认为线性插值。其值可为'nearest' 最近项插值...